MESSY PAINT WORKSHOP
To provide you with the best experience, cookies are used on this site. Find out more here.

Sun 1 Jun | 2025 | 12.30pm
Performing Arts Studio | Lakeside Arts
Tickets: £6
1 hour
Suitable for 3-6 years
In this fun, hands-on workshop, children will explore the joy of painting without the worry of staying neat.
Splatter, smear, and swirl your way to your very own masterpiece as we dive into the world of bold colours, swirling brushstrokes, and exciting textures.
This workshop is designed for parents or carers to stay and watch the creativity unfold. Tickets only need to be booked for children attending.
